Elevation analysis computing the Openness Parameters as proposed by Yokohama et al 2002
to:
Elevation analysis computing the Openness Parameters as proposed by Ryuzo Yokoyama, Mlchlo Shlrasawa, and Richard J. Pike (2002) Visualizing Topography by Openness: A New Application of Image Processing to Digital Elevation Models; Photogrammetric Engineering & Remote Sensing Vol. 68, No. 3, March 2002, pp. 257-265.
